Murder Will Out: The First Step In Crime Leads To The Gallows, The Horrors Of The Queen City (1867) is a book written by William L. De Beck. The book is a true crime story that takes place in Cincinnati, Ohio in the mid-19th century. It follows the story of a murder case from the beginning to the end, detailing the investigation, trial, and execution of the perpetrator. The book provides a detailed account of the crime, the evidence, and the trial proceedings, as well as the social and political context of the time. It also explores the impact of the crime on the community and the psychological effects on those involved.
